This park offers so much diversity when it comes to workouts—it’s great for the whole family and is peaceful and relaxing. It reminds me of Central Park—on a smaller scale. Walk or run a 6-km lap of the main park, or add hill runs and path extensions for 8 km. There are also football fields for bodyweight training and pull-up bars in an outdoor gym. Centennial is also great for cycling and has dedicated bike lanes. You can hire bikes at a number of places around the park and explore the neighbourhood for an hour or a day—there are plenty of great picnic spots along the way.
